Capable of speeds in excess of 300 mph, the 1942 Mark XII Hawker Hurricane was one of the most versatile fighters in the Royal Air Force's fleet during World War II. The Hurricane was somewhat unfairly overshadowed by the more glamorous Supermarine Spitfire even though the Hurricane was responsible for 60 percent of the Royal Air Force victories in the Battle of Britain.

Find out why this Hurricane, the first eight-gun monoplane fighter produced by Britain, played such a significant role in a major turning point in the war.
